Aharmunda - Narayangarh, Paschim Medinipur

Aharmunda is a village situated in the Narayangarh subdivision of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al. Kashipur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Aharmunda village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Aharmunda is 342961. The village covers a total geographical area of 249.55 hectares and falls under the 721424 pincode. Kharagpur is the nearest town, located about 42 km away.

Aharmunda village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Pradhan serving as the elected head.

Population of Aharmunda

According to the 2011 Census, Aharmunda village had a total population of 1,172 people, including 603 males and 569 females, living in 266 households. The sex ratio was 944 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 70.56%, with male literacy at 80.34% and female literacy at 60.20%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 94,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 674.

Transport and Connectivity of Aharmunda

Aharmunda is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Bakhrabad, while the nearest airport is Behala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 87.0 km.
